Revolutionizing Operations: The Importance Of A Manufacturing Inventory Management System

In the fast-paced world of manufacturing, keeping track of inventory can be a daunting task. With constantly changing demands, fluctuating market trends, and the need for accurate and timely information, having an efficient and effective inventory management system is crucial to the success of a manufacturing operation. This is where a manufacturing inventory management system comes into play.

A manufacturing inventory management system is a software solution that helps manufacturers track and manage their inventory in real-time. It provides visibility into inventory levels, locations, and movements, allowing companies to make informed decisions about procurement, production, and distribution. With the help of this system, manufacturers can optimize their inventory levels, reduce carrying costs, minimize stockouts, and improve overall operational efficiency.

One of the key benefits of a manufacturing inventory management system is the ability to automate inventory tracking and monitoring. By using barcode scanning, RFID technology, or other automated data capture methods, companies can eliminate manual data entry errors and streamline their inventory management processes. This not only saves time and resources but also ensures the accuracy of inventory information, which is essential for making informed decisions and meeting customer demands.

Another advantage of a manufacturing inventory management system is the ability to optimize inventory levels and reduce carrying costs. By analyzing historical data, demand forecasts, and lead times, companies can set optimal reorder points, safety stock levels, and order quantities. This helps prevent stockouts and overstock situations, leading to lower carrying costs, improved cash flow, and increased profitability.

Furthermore, a manufacturing inventory management system helps improve inventory accuracy and visibility. By maintaining real-time inventory data and tracking inventory movements across multiple locations, companies can easily identify discrepancies, theft, or shrinkage. This allows for timely corrective actions, such as conducting cycle counts, investigating discrepancies, or implementing security measures, to ensure the integrity of inventory data.

Additionally, a manufacturing inventory management system enables companies to monitor and control inventory levels throughout the entire supply chain. By integrating with suppliers, distributors, and other partners, manufacturers can track inventory movements, lead times, and order statuses in real-time. This visibility helps streamline procurement processes, reduce lead times, and improve on-time deliveries, leading to better customer satisfaction and loyalty.

Moreover, a manufacturing inventory management system provides valuable insights and analytics for decision-making. By generating reports, dashboards, and alerts, companies can analyze trends, identify inefficiencies, and make data-driven decisions to improve their inventory management practices. This allows for better forecasting, planning, and optimization of inventory levels, leading to improved operational efficiency and profitability.
